About The Book

Between 1930 and 1960 popular female dramatists including Paola Riccora Anna Bonacci Clotilde Masci and Gici Ganzini Granata set the stage for a new generation of feminist theatre and the development of contemporary Italian women's theatre as a whole. Now largely forgotten the lives and works of these dramatists are reintroduced into the scholarly conversation in Italian Women's Theatre 1930-1960. Following a general introduction the book presents a selection of dramatic works rounded out by commentary performance histories critical analyses and biographical information.
